The M.Sc. Medical Systems Engineering program at Otto von Guericke University Magdeburg is a multidisciplinary course designed to equip students with cutting-edge skills in medical technology, informatics, and physics. Through hands-on clinical experience, research opportunities, and collaboration with industry leaders, students are prepared to innovate and lead in the rapidly evolving field of medical systems engineering. With a focus on practical applications, international exposure, and state-of-the-art facilities, this program offers a unique blend of academic excellence and real-world relevance.

Requirements
Qualification Requirements
The application requirements for the study program in “Medical Systems Enginееring” are:
A bachelor's (or equivalent) degree in:
- Medical Engineering
- Electrical Engineering
- Information Technology
- Computer Science
- Or any comparable technical courses
The graduated degree should show :
- at least 20 CP (according to ECTS) in the field of mathematics
- at least 20 CP (according to ECTS) in the field of electrical and information technology/electronics
- at least 15 CP (according to ECTS) in the field of physics/medical physics
- at least 10 CP (according to ECTS) in the field of computer science/programming
- at least 5 CP (according to ECTS) in the field of anatomy/physiolοgу.
At least 'good' grade (up to 2.5 in the German academic grading systеm)

The Masters in Medical Systems Engineering (MSE) program at the OVGU provided an interdisciplinary and collaborative learning environment made possible by the faculty members representing diverse research areas addressing clinical needs and patient care. Coming from a more rigid undergraduate curriculum in the United States, I appreciated the hands-on and flexible coursework options made available in the MSE program, which allowed me to explore and take ownership of my education experience. For example, the industry internship under the research track option was a great opportunity to dig into a research problem while gaining experience at a leading healthcare company. The MSE program at the OVGU set me up for success in a PhD program in the United States, which later led to a faculty appointment at the PhD-granting institution. I am very pleased and proud to be a part of the OVGU alumni.
After graduating from high school, I was determined to start the bachelor's degree program in medical technology at the OVGU. In the meantime, I quickly realized in addition to all the theory in my studies, practical experience is essential to become a good engineer. At the STIMULATE Institute I worked on various projects in the field of computer and magnetic resonance imaging. This gave me the chance to do research on a Tabletop MR at the master's degree Medical Sysrtems Engineering in cooperation with Dr. Thomas Witzel at the Athinoula A. Martinos Center (Harward Medical School & MIT) in Boston. This significantly improved my expertise. The MSE program in close cooperation with STIMULATE offers many opportunities for theoretical but also practical teaching, especially in the field of imaging techniques.
